There are several options for getting from Orange to Beynac-et-Cazenac by train, bus, car and plane. The cheapest option is to take the bus and then take the train which costs around €100 ($100) and will take around 10hrs. If you need to get there more quickly, you can take the train and then fly and arrive in approximately 5hrs, though it is a bit more costly at approximately €255 ($255).
The distance between Orange and Beynac-et-Cazenac is around 515km (320 miles). In a direct line (as the crow flies), the distance is 302km (188 miles)
It takes around 5h 40m to get from Orange and Beynac-et-Cazenac by train. If you are travelling by car it will take around 5h 10m to drive there.
The quickest way to get from Orange to Beynac-et-Cazenac is to take the train and then fly which takes around 5hrs and will set you back approx €255 ($255).
The cheapest way to travel between Orange and Beynac-et-Cazenac, if you exclude driving, is to take the bus and then take the train which will typically cost around €100 ($100) for a standard one-way ticket.
Yes there is a train service that runs between Orange and Beynac-et-Cazenac. It typically takes around 5h 40m and departs 5 times a day.
There are no direct train services that runs from Orange to Beynac-et-Cazenac. However, you can instead can take several connecting trains with a changeover in Avignon Centre, Nimes, Montauban Ville Bourbon and Gourdon. These services run 5 times a day and will take a minimum of 5h 40m.
SNCF run train services between Orange and Beynac-et-Cazenac. Trains depart 5 times a day and will take around 5h 40m, however, this may vary depending on the particular service and whether it runs express or stops all stations.
Yes there is a bus that runs regularly from Orange and Beynac-et-Cazenac. It typically takes around 9h 55m and departs 5 times a week.
There are no direct bus services that runs from Orange to Beynac-et-Cazenac. However, you can instead can take several connecting buses with changeovers in Le Lac le Pontet, Agen, Gare Quai 7 and Belves. These services run 5 times a week and will take a minimum of 9h 55m.
FlixBus and SNCF Bus run regular bus services between Orange and Beynac-et-Cazenac. Buses run 5 times a week and take around 9h 55m on average but will vary depending on you book with.
It doesn't look like you can fly directly from Orange to Beynac-et-Cazenac. We recommend that you take the train to Lyon-Saint Exupery Tgv then fly from Lyon (LYS) to Toulouse (TLS) then take the train to Gourdon. instead which will take 5hrs.
The closest major airport to Beynac-et-Cazenac is Aurillac Airport (AUR) (AUR) which is approximately 102km (63 miles) from Beynac-et-Cazenac. Toulouse–Blagnac Airport (TLS) (TLS) and Bordeaux–Mérignac Airport (BOD) (BOD) are also nearby and might be a better alternative airport depending on where you are flying from.
Yes it is possible to drive from Orange and Beynac-et-Cazenac. The distance is around 515km (320 miles) by road and it will take around 5h 10m in normal traffic conditons.
If you don't have a car, the easiest way to get from Orange to Beynac-et-Cazenac is to take the train which takes, on average, 5h 40m and will usually cost around €165 ($165).
